01 — Support

Support our work

Individuals, institutions and businesses can support the Foundation’s education, healthcare, capacity-building and humanitarian programmes.

Support can be directed towards a particular focus area or left to be applied where the need is greatest. Before anything is agreed, we will explain what the contribution would be used for and how it will be accounted for.

Please note: the Foundation does not collect donations through this website, and there is no online payment facility here. All support arrangements are discussed and confirmed directly through our official contact channels, listed below. Please treat any other request for payment in the Foundation’s name with caution.

02 — Volunteer

Volunteer your time or expertise

If you would like to give your time, professional skill or experience, we would like to hear from you.

Prospective volunteers are welcome to contact the Foundation to enquire about opportunities. Please tell us what you do, the time you can realistically offer and the area of work that interests you. We will respond honestly about whether there is currently a role in which your contribution would be useful.

We would rather tell you that nothing suitable is open at the moment than accept an offer we cannot put to good use.

Useful things to include

  • Your professional background or area of skill
  • The focus area you are most interested in
  • How much time you can realistically commit
  • Whether you are available in Abuja or remotely
